Selma revealed her battle with multiple sclerosis back in October 2018, while Michael has been managing Parkinson’s disease since 1991. These two legends have a lot in common, and their bond is built on shared experiences and mutual understanding.
“He got in touch with me and we had a conversation,” Selma once revealed on Good Morning America. She added, “Really, he gives me hope. Plus, I was like, ‘I have Michael J. Fox’s email now—I’m pretty cool.’” That’s the kind of authenticity we all need more of in life.

A Candid Look at Challenges
Selma hasn’t shied away from sharing her struggles. Recently, she addressed concerns after a photo surfaced of her friend Sarah Michelle Gellar pushing her in a wheelchair during a Disneyland outing. “I can stand. I can walk,” she reassured her followers on Instagram. “But that uses up the whole day of energy.” Selma explained that she was still experiencing an exacerbation, which meant using a wheelchair was necessary for conserving energy. “I busted my tailbone or would use my #alinker… Seriously. Thank you Sarah and @jaime_king who basically saved me last week. And @reesewitherspoon who sent food for the weekend. I love you all.”
